Police Investigates FPI Affiliation with Terrorist Suspects

TEMPO.CO, Jakarta - The Metro Jaya Police is currently investigating the affiliation between restricted organization FPI (Islamic Defender Front) and suspected terrorist in Condet identified as HH. During HH's arrest, Police discovered FPI's attributes such as books, shirts, and calendar.

"Yes, including [finding of FPI's attributes], if there is an affiliation it is just a preliminary finding, it is being investigated by Densus 88," said Metro Jaya Police Chief Inspector General Mohammad Fadil Imran on Monday, March 29, 2021.

Fadil refused to make further speculations concerning the possible affiliation of the group with the recently arrested terrorist group.

"What is important is efforts to carry acts of terror by using explosives or bombs in Jakarta are being monitored, detected, and prevented," Fadil said.

During a press release at the Metro Jaya Police headquarter, several swords and books and FPI attributes were present. One of the items was a book titled "FPI Amar Ma'ruf Nahi Munkar". In addition, there was a green and white shirt with 'Laskar Pembela Islam' presented during the press release.

Tempo also noted two FPI identity card with HH's name on it. Vide CD's and posters of former FPI leader Rizieq Shihab were also confiscated by the Police.
